Will European flights get low compensation?

Consumer associations suggest that the European standards update proposal for compensation may lose 85% of passengers in the event of flight delays.

Advertisement

European flight passengers can face New difficulties in getting Compensation for delays. The European Union has reviewed the regulations since 2004, but the text has been detecting political obstacles. Civil community and aircraft community asks it The text has been updatedBut do not share the same analysis.

Currently, can be obtained Compensation from 250 to 600 euros For 3 hours or more delays. But the current negotiations can lead to New unfavorable standards for consumersAccording to Beuc (European Consumer System). “The commission proposed to change the compensation period, and it will no longer be three hours, but depending on the distance five, nine or twelve (twelve).

Impact on consumer

In particular, what impact does this have? If it is currently discussed, 85% of the consumers will no longer have the right Compensation“He told Steven Berger, the legal specialist of Beuc,” EuroNius’. This is a great step in compared to the 2004 law. “

This order applies to all flights that leave an airport Ue. This does not apply to Europe’s flights operated by airlines outside the European Union or EU planes in Europe.

Regulation applies to all member states Iceland, Norway and Switzerland. “Extraordinary situations”, ie extreme weather, air traffic control controls, strikes, employees of staff Air company And political instability.

Beuc too Criticize the expected deadline To implement the rights of passengers. “At this time, what’s on the table (…) You only have three months If you have any problems with the airline, it is very low, ”says Steven Berger.

Flexibility protected by airlines

The ongoing debates between member states are based on a plan presented Authority In 2013. Again, the civil society considers that the text has expired and is not similar to the needs and demands of the current travelers. As for airlines, on the other hand, this document has been a good discussion platform 10 years ago.

A4E Association (Airlines 4 Euro), its companies represent 70% of European air transportHe wrote to explain, “The 2013 European Commission’s Dedicated proposal helps to protect the flights and fulfill the main priority of the passengers: they can soon achieve their goal.” According to A4E, ”Current law It is still vague, creating uncertainty for passengers, airlines and courts. ”

Consumer associations indicate the need to review even though the compensation for delays and cancellation is at the center of difficulties The role of travel intermediaries. These are sites for comparing air tickets, reserve and purchase, but they are not subject to standards installed in the 2004 text.

Poland, who uses the European Union’s half -hearted presidency, wants to take care of the trophy and advance to June as much as possible. At this time, negotiations are formed at the technical level They have not yet reached politics.
